My principal research interests lie in the field of cognitive neuroscience of addiction. I am currently leading a research team in investigating the cognitive mechanism of Internet addiction disorder (IAD, or pathological Internet use). The research is funded by National Science Foundation of China (Grant No.30900405). My research program aims to elucidate the neuro-cognitive basis of Internet addiction disorder using a combination of experimental methods. We study the inter-related cognitive functions of inhibitory control, attentional selection, decision-making, and the impairment in rewarding or punishing system in IADs. The experimental methods we employ include ERP and functional brain imaging.
